At least 17 people lost their lives in a devastating fire that broke out early Sunday morning in a commercial-residential building near Gulzar Houz, close to the iconic Charminar in Hyderabad’s Old City.

Emergency responders received the first alert around 6:30 a.m., according to fire department officials. Firefighters and rescue teams rushed to the scene and began evacuation and firefighting operations. Several individuals were found unconscious inside the building and were immediately shifted to nearby hospitals.

Preliminary reports suggest that the building had two critical access points: a narrow entrance leading to a first-floor residence and a wider one to an enclosed shopping area. The limited access is believed to have significantly hampered rescue efforts and contributed to the high death toll.

Telangana Chief Minister A. Revanth Reddy expressed deep shock over the tragedy and instructed senior officials to ensure swift rescue operations and medical assistance for the injured. He has also directed a comprehensive investigation into the cause of the fire and the building’s compliance with fire safety norms.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i expressed condolences and announced an ex-gratia for the families of the deceased.

Rescue efforts are still underway as firefighters continue to search the premises for any remaining victims or signs of structural damage.
